    Troy Edwards, deputy chief of the National Security Section and son-in-law of former FBI Director James Comey, resigned from the Justice Department immediately following Comey's indictment. Citing his "oath to the Constitution," Edwards left his prestigious position in the same Virginia office that charged his father-in-law, highlighting growing tensions within the department that recently also saw the dismissal of Comey's daughter from her federal prosecution role.
